Output 94e585a49926dd310fbaedd3b55a0532e82a202b9993c253a6c411d4bf0e2f44:6

value
321487315
script pubkey
OP_0 OP_PUSHBYTES_20 18bb792f103a84e8c66430a482f822e316e7cb54
address
bc1qrzahjtcs82zw33nyxzjg97pzuvtw0j65mszzt8
transaction
94e585a49926dd310fbaedd3b55a0532e82a202b9993c253a6c411d4bf0e2f44
confirmations
80048
spent
true